Dive Brief:
- General Mills has filed a patent for a granola process that can delivered toasted flavor without any of the baking that is traditionally required, FoodProductionDaily.com reports.
- The company expects the process to speed up production lines and achieve more uniform results than baking would normally achieve.
- The process can be used for granola bars, cereal products and even other grains and ingredients.
